Output 332268c08c668807042b0ee2557cfb3e0bf5b1bfb30cae38a57cc4b0d5407e86:5

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f270fcbdd267bbec54740503806aaf80b92475de OP_EQUAL
address
3PnvoTdaCkrXqGEiiX9xViA1RcbR4tjX5v
transaction
332268c08c668807042b0ee2557cfb3e0bf5b1bfb30cae38a57cc4b0d5407e86
confirmations
64005
spent
true